How Does VPS Hosting Boost IoT Device Connectivity Reliability?
VPS hosting enhances IoT connectivity reliability by providing dedicated resources, scalable infrastructure, and low-latency performance. Unlike shared hosting, VPS isolates server environments, ensuring consistent uptime and secure data transmission for IoT devices. Features like automated backups, global server distribution, and real-time monitoring further stabilize connections, making it ideal for mission-critical IoT applications.

How Does VPS Hosting Improve IoT Network Stability?

VPS hosting allocates dedicated RAM, CPU, and storage to IoT networks, minimizing resource contention. By eliminating “noisy neighbor” effects common in shared hosting, latency spikes are reduced. Advanced load-balancing algorithms distribute traffic across virtualized servers, maintaining sub-100ms response times even during peak IoT data surges. Providers like Redway leverage SSD-backed NVMe storage to ensure 99.95% uptime for sensor data streams.

Modern VPS configurations now incorporate adaptive bandwidth allocation that automatically prioritizes mission-critical IoT traffic. For smart city deployments handling simultaneous video feeds and environmental sensors, this results in 40% fewer data collisions compared to conventional cloud setups. Network slicing techniques allow creation of isolated channels for different IoT device categories – industrial PLCs might get guaranteed 50Mbps lanes while occupancy sensors operate in low-bandwidth tiers. This granular control prevents cascading failures during network stress events.

What Security Features Make VPS Critical for IoT Ecosystems?

VPS solutions for IoT implement TLS 1.3 encryption, hardware firewalls, and AI-driven intrusion detection. Isolated environments prevent lateral movement of potential breaches between devices. Regular firmware patching cycles (often hourly) address zero-day vulnerabilities in IoT protocols like MQTT. Two-factor authentication and biometric access controls add granular security layers uncommon in traditional cloud IoT platforms.

Which Scalability Benefits Does VPS Offer for Expanding IoT Networks?

VPS allows instant provisioning of additional virtual cores and RAM through hypervisor-level scaling. IoT deployments can dynamically adjust resources based on device count fluctuations—Redway’s benchmarks show 500-node networks scaling to 50,000+ devices with <1% packet loss. Vertical scaling preserves existing IP configurations, avoiding network topology changes that disrupt industrial IoT operations during expansion phases.

Device Count Scaling Time Packet Loss
1,000 2.1s 0.3%
10,000 4.8s 0.7%
50,000 8.5s 0.9%

The table above demonstrates linear performance degradation even during massive scaling events. This predictability enables IoT operators to maintain SLA compliance during rapid growth periods. Cold migration capabilities allow moving entire device clusters between physical hosts without service interruption – critical for healthcare IoT systems requiring 24/7 uptime.

Why Is Edge Computing Integration Vital in VPS for IoT?

VPS providers now colocate servers with 5G MEC (Multi-Access Edge Compute) nodes, enabling <20ms processing loops for time-sensitive IoT tasks. This edge-VPS hybrid architecture allows localized AI inference for smart cameras/robotics without cloud roundtrips. Redway's tests show 78% bandwidth reduction for video analytics IoT systems when using edge-optimized VPS configurations compared to centralized cloud hosting.

How Do VPS Solutions Reduce IoT Operational Costs?

Pay-as-you-grow VPS models eliminate upfront hardware costs for IoT deployments. Energy-efficient ARM-based VPS instances now handle 2.4x more device connections per watt than x86 servers. Automated resource scaling during off-peak hours can lower connectivity costs by 33% for circadian IoT networks. FAQs

Q: Can VPS handle real-time IoT data processing?
A: Yes—premium VPS plans support real-time analytics through in-memory databases like RedisTimeSeries, processing 100,000+ data points/sec with sub-millisecond latency.
Q: How does VPS compare to PaaS for IoT?
A: VPS offers greater protocol flexibility (CoAP, LwM2M, etc.) versus locked-in PaaS ecosystems, crucial for industrial IoT legacy systems.
Q: What backup solutions exist for IoT VPS?
A: Leading providers offer blockchain-secured, incremental backups with versioning—critical for maintaining audit trails in regulated IoT verticals like healthcare.
